Throughout June and heading into the all-important July recruiting period, Jeff Goodman and Jeff Borzello will take a look at the summer checklists for the top 50 programs in college basketball, as revealed in Goodman's preseason ballot published in late May. Goodman and Borzello will show you each roster the way the program's coaches are looking at it, projecting graduation/NBA casualties and areas of need ahead of 2016-17. Below is the summer guide for the Oregon Ducks.

Scholarship chart
Seniors (3): F Dwayne Benjamin, SF Elgin Cook, G Dylan Ennis
Juniors (1): PF Chris Boucher
Sophomores (5): PF/C Jordan Bell, PG Casey Benson, F Dillon Brooks, PG Ahmaad Rorie, C Roman Sorkin
Freshmen (3): G Tyler Dorsey, PF Trevor Manuel, PG Kendall Small
Possible early entry losses after next season: None
Available scholarships for 2016: Four
Committed prospects for 2016 and beyond: SF Keith Smith (Class of 2016, Northwest XPress)
Biggest needs for 2016-17: Point guard, wing and a big man
Must-haves: C Abdulhakim Ado (No. 31, Georgia Stars)
Targets: SG Malik Monk (No. 5 in ESPN 100, Arkansas Wings), C Abdulhakim Ado (No. 31, Georgia Stars), SG-SF Vance Jackson (No. 34, Dream Vision), C Isaac Humphries (No. 50, ESPN, Spiece Indy Heat), PG Koby McEwen (No. 71 CIA Bounce), PF Eddie Ekiyor (CIA Bounce), G Will McDowell-White (Australia), PF Kassoum Yakwe (No. 100, PSA Cardinals), C Samuel Japhet-Mathias (PSA Cardinals), PF Kalif Young (Canada)
Summer scenario
Oregon suffered a major blow heading into July when five-star Canadian guard Jamal Murray announced he was committing to Kentucky and reclassifying into 2015. Murray was Oregon's top priority -- in both 2015 and 2016 -- and the Ducks had invested more time and resources into his recruitment than had any other school. With Murray no longer an option, Oregon still has three scholarships left to give, with four-star wing Keith Smith out of Seattle already committed for 2016. The Ducks will have eight freshmen and sophomores this season, so they can be a little more choosy. Malik Monk and Abdul Ado are atop the wish list at the wing and big man positions, but Dana Altman also wants a point guard.
